#6d57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d57ec is composed of 42.7% red, 34.1%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 63.3%. #6d57ec color hex could be obtained by blending #daaeff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6d57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d57ec has RGB values of R:109, G:87,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 7165932.

Shades and Tints of #6d57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020108 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d57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09fa4 is the less saturated color, while #6349fa is the most saturated one.
